To determine the closure status of River Bend Golf Course, it's essential to rely on official sources rather than unverified information. The most direct and reliable method is to visit the golf course's official website. Most golf courses maintain a dedicated section for announcements, updates, or news where closures due to weather, maintenance, or other reasons are posted. Look for a tab labeled "News," "Updates," or "Announcements" on the homepage.

Another authoritative source is the golf course's social media accounts. Platforms like Facebook, Instagram, or Twitter are often used to share real-time updates. Follow or check the official River Bend Golf Course account for posts or pinned announcements regarding closures. Social media is particularly useful for urgent updates, as it allows for immediate communication with patrons.

For those who prefer direct communication, contacting the golf course via phone or email is a straightforward approach. The contact information is typically listed on the official website. A quick call to the pro shop or an email inquiry can provide immediate clarification on the course's operational status. This method ensures you receive the most current and accurate information directly from the source.

Local government or park district websites can also be valuable resources, especially if River Bend Golf Course is part of a public park system. These sites often include updates on facility closures, maintenance schedules, and other pertinent information. Check the "Parks and Recreation" or "Facilities" section for relevant announcements.

Lastly, consider subscribing to the golf course's newsletter or alert system if available. Many courses offer email or text notifications for important updates, including closures. This proactive approach ensures you stay informed without constantly checking for updates manually. By leveraging these official channels, you can confidently determine whether River Bend Golf Course is closed and plan your visit accordingly.
